    Welcome to the Official #EastEnders Channel! Following the residents of Albert Square as their lives intertwine with drama and tears. First broadcasted in 1985, EastEnders continues to be one of the UK's most watched programmes as well as the nation's favourite soap. EastEnders has won multiple BAFTA and National Television Awards for "Most Popular Serial Drama".

    @TheBooshBabe 5 месяцев назад +35

    The repercussions of this affair are unsurpassed...
    1. Tanya trying to bury Max alive.
    2. Tanya getting with Jack.
    3. Lauren trying to run Max over.
    4. Stacey killing Archie.
    5. Bradley's death.
    6. Lauren's alcoholism
    7. Kirsty Branning.
    8. Max getting sent down for Lucy's murder.
    9. Lauren and Abi falling off the roof of the Vic.
    10. Abi's Death and Lauren leaving.
